Here are the essential units for a Postgraduate Certificate in Emergency Response for Food Festivals:
• Incident Management in Food Festivals: This unit covers the fundamental principles of incident management in food festival settings. It includes risk assessment, crisis management, and emergency response planning.
• Food Safety and Hygiene: This unit covers the essential aspects of food safety and hygiene in food festivals. It includes food handling, storage, preparation, and service, as well as regulatory compliance.
• Emergency Planning and Procedures: This unit covers the development and implementation of emergency plans and procedures for food festivals. It includes evacuation procedures, communication plans, and resource management.
• Crowd Management and Control: This unit covers the principles of crowd management and control in food festivals. It includes crowd analysis, risk assessment, and emergency response planning.
• Medical and First Aid: This unit covers the provision of medical and first aid services in food festivals. It includes first aid training, emergency medical services, and incident management.
• Fire Safety: This unit covers the principles of fire safety in food festivals. It includes fire risk assessment, fire prevention, and emergency response planning.
• Security Management: This unit covers the management of security in food festivals. It includes security planning, threat assessment, and incident management.
• Environmental Management: This unit covers the principles of environmental management in food festivals. It includes waste management, energy efficiency, and sustainability.
